This article is intended for parents to understand how to complete the Wyoming ESA Program Application.

Step 2: Student Information
Provide the information for the first student you are applying for:
- Student's Legal First Name
- Student's Legal Middle Name (optional)
- Student's Legal Last Name
- Student's Date of Birth
- Student must be between 4 and 21 years old as of August 1, 2025
- Verify that the date of birth is entered correctly
- Grade Level for the 2025-2026 academic year
- Student's Social Security Number (SSN)
- Verify that the social security number is entered correctly
- Identity Document Upload (student's birth certificate or passport)

- If the student resides in your household, ensure the box next to [Student lives at the same address as provided for Parent/Guardian] has a checkmark.
- If the student does NOT reside with you, click on the box next to [Same Address as Parent/Guardian] to remove the checkmark. Then, provide the student's residential address.
- Adding Additional Students:
- If you want to apply for another student, click on the [Add Another Student] button and fill out all the information as mentioned above.
- If you click to add a student, but you will NOT be adding another, click on [Remove Student] to remove the new profile.
- If you want to apply for another student, click on the [Add Another Student] button and fill out all the information as mentioned above.
- Please note that all students within a household must be on the same application. You cannot submit separate applications for different students, so be sure to include all students before moving on to step 3.
- When you are finished, click [Next]

Step 5: Verification Documents
If needed, we will ask you to provide residency and/or income verification documents.
- Once you have the documents on hand, click [Verify Now] to begin.
Proof of address document:
- Click on the dropdown and select the document you will upload. Then click [Continue].
- Select how you will upload your photo or document:
- Camera icon: If you are using your phone, click here to take a photo of the document.
- Upload a photo: If the document is saved on your device, click here to select and upload it.
- Continue on a device: After clicking here, you will be able to scan a QR code and finish the document upload process on another device (e.g. your phone). It also allows you to send it to yourself by email.
- Upload the document and verify that the name and address are visible.
- If everything is correct, click [Submit]
- You will have 3 opportunities to upload the document.
- Please note if you select a utility bill, you will be asked to upload two (2) different utility bills dated within the last 90 days.

Step 6: Selecting a School
If your status is Eligible or Under Review, you'll be able to select the school your student will attend.
- Click on the dropdown that says [Search for a school].
- Scroll until you find your school of choice, "Homeschool" or "Other School".
- If you select one of the schools on the dropdown, you'll be able to use the ESA funds for tuition & fees.
- If you select "Homeschool" or "Other School", ESA funds can't be used to pay tuition & fees. They may be applied towards other qualified educational expenses, such as curriculum, educational materials, tutoring, and technology.
- Please note: The school selection process in the Odyssey Portal is separate from the school enrollment process. That process remains between the parent and the school.
- Select and click on the best option for your student.
- Click [Enroll now].
- If applicable, repeat the process for all students you applied for.
- Wait for the school to verify the school selection.
